Prime Minister calls eastern Barta’a Mayor to check on citizens following Israeli demolitions

 

 

Directs relevant authorities to mobilize greater international pressure to halt Israeli crimes

 

RAMALLAH, June 14, 2026 (WAFA) — Prime Minister Mohammad Mustafa on Sunday spoke by telephone with the Mayor of Eastern Barta’a in Jenin, Ghassan Kabha, to check on the conditions of citizens following the large-scale demolition campaign carried out by Israeli occupation forces in the Khour Al-Daba’a area of the town.

The Prime Minister instructed all relevant government institutions, particularly the Ministry of Foreign Affairs and Expatriates, to intensify diplomatic efforts and mobilize greater international pressure to halt the escalating crimes committed by the Israeli occupation against the Palestinian people, especially home demolitions, forced displacement measures, and attacks carried out by colonial settler militias.

Earlier today, Israeli occupation forces launched a large-scale demolition operation targeting residential buildings inhabited by more than 100 citizens, in addition to commercial structures and storage facilities in the town of Eastern Barta’a, west of Jenin in the occupied northern West Bank. The operation was accompanied by a heavy military deployment throughout the area, while demolition notices affecting at least 120 additional structures have also been issued.

It is worth noting that this is the second demolition campaign carried out by Israeli occupation forces in Barta’a within a single week. Last Monday, occupation bulldozers demolished eight homes and additional structures in the same area as part of an ongoing demolition campaign targeting the town.
